Показать сообщение отдельно
Старый 28.08.2011, 14:34   #1
Новичок
 
Регистрация: 22.08.2011
Сообщений: 10
Сказал Спасибо: 0
Имеет 0 спасибок в 0 сообщенях
nontxt пока неопределено
Вопрос Сервер не пускает с newxor.dll

Доброе время суток.
Юзаю l2phx.3.5.33.172
Собственно дело в том, что сервер не пускает с исходником из этой темы Как писать newxor.dll
Без него пускает,а с ним доходит только до выбора серва.
Сервер High Five новый, очень много багов и недочетов, (даже оли с багами).

И как я понимаю, с этого исходника newxor.dll это стандартная шифрация?

Компилил Delphi 7. Навыки работы с ним имеются.

И да, алгоритм шифровки ведь в этой операции?:

Код:

Код:
procedure TXorCodingOut.InitKey(const XorKey; Interlude: Boolean);
const
  KeyConst: array[0..3] of Byte = ($A1,$6C,$54,$87);
  KeyIntrl: array[0..7] of Byte = ($C8,$27,$93,$01,$A1,$6C,$31,$97);
var key2:array[0..15] of Byte;
begin
  if Interlude then begin
    keyLen:=15;
    Move(XorKey,key2,8);
    Move(KeyIntrl,key2[8],8);
  end else begin
    keyLen:=7;
    Move(XorKey,key2,4);
    Move(KeyConst,key2[4],4);
  end;
  Move(key2,GKeyS,16);
  Move(key2,GKeyR,16);
end;
Вложения
Тип файла: rar newxor.rar (1.9 Кб, 125 просмотров)
nontxt вне форума   Ответить с цитированием